//////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////
// This is a driver for 122x32 pixel graphic displays based on the //
// SED1520 Controller connected to the parallel port. Check //
// www.adams-online.de/lcd for where to buy //
// and how to build the hardware. This Controller has no built in //
// character generator. Therefore all fonts and pixels are generated //
// by this driver. //
// //
// This driver is based on drv_base.c and hd44780.c. //
// The HD44780 font in sed1520fm.c was shamelessly stolen from //
// Michael Reinelt / lcd4linux and is (C) 2000 by him. //
// The rest of fontmap.c and this driver is //
// //
// Moved the delay timing code by Charles Steinkuehler to timing.h. //
// Guillaume Filion <gfk@logidac.com>, December 2001 //
// //
// (C) 2001 Robin Adams ( robin@adams-online.de ) //
// //
// This driver is released under the GPL. See file COPYING in this //
// package for further details. //
//////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////

#define A0 0x08
#define CS2 0x04
#define CS1 0x02
#define WR 0x01
#define IODELAY 500
#include "shared/str.h"
#include "lcd.h"
#include "sed1520.h"
#include "report.h"
static unsigned int port = LPTPORT;
static unsigned char *framebuf = NULL;
static int width = LCD_DEFAULT_WIDTH;
static int height = LCD_DEFAULT_HEIGHT;
static int cellwidth = LCD_DEFAULT_CELLWIDTH;
static int cellheight = LCD_DEFAULT_CELLHEIGHT;
// Vars for the server core
MODULE_EXPORT char *api_version = API_VERSION;
MODULE_EXPORT int stay_in_foreground = 0;
MODULE_EXPORT int supports_multiple = 0;
MODULE_EXPORT char *symbol_prefix = "sed1520_";
/////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////
// writes command value to one or both sed1520 selected by chip
//
void
writecommand (unsigned int port, int value, int chip)
{
port_out(port, value);
port_out(port + 2, WR + CS1 - (chip & CS1) + (chip & CS2));
port_out(port + 2, CS1 - (chip & CS1) + (chip & CS2));
uPause(IODELAY);
port_out(port + 2, WR + CS1 - (chip & CS1) + (chip & CS2));
uPause(IODELAY);
}
/////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////
// writes data value to one or both sed 1520 selected by chip
//
void
writedata (unsigned int port, int value, int chip)
{
port_out(port, value);
port_out(port + 2, A0 + WR + CS1 - (chip & CS1) + (chip & CS2));
port_out(port + 2, A0 + CS1 - (chip & CS1) + (chip & CS2));
uPause(IODELAY);
port_out(port + 2, A0 + WR + CS1 - (chip & CS1) + (chip & CS2));
uPause(IODELAY);
}
/////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////
// selects a page (=row) on both sed1520s
//
void
selectpage (unsigned int port, int page)
{
writecommand(port, 0xB8 + (page & 0x03), CS1 + CS2);
}
/////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////
// selects a column on the sed1520s specified by chip
//
void
selectcolumn (unsigned int port, int column, int chip)
{
writecommand(port, (column & 0x7F), chip);
}
/////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////
// draws char z from fontmap to the framebuffer at position
// x,y. These are zero-based textmode positions.
// The Fontmap is stored in rows while the framebuffer is stored
// in columns, so we need a little conversion.
//
void
drawchar2fb (unsigned char *framebuf, int x, int y, unsigned char z)
{
int i, j;
if ((x < 0) || (x > 19) || (y < 0) || (y > 3))
return;
for (i = 6; i > 0; i--) {
int k = 0;
for (j = 0; j < 7; j++) {
k += (((fontmap[(int) z][j] * 2) & (1 << i)) / (1 << i)) *
(1 << j);
}
framebuf[(y * 122) + (x * 6) + (6 - i)] = k;
}
}
/////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////
// This initialises the stuff. We support supplying port as
// a command line argument.
//
MODULE_EXPORT int
sed1520_init (Driver *drvthis)
{
/* Read config file */
/* What port to use */
port = drvthis->config_get_int(drvthis->name, "Port", 0, LPTPORT);
/* End of config file parsing */
if (timing_init() == -1) {
report(RPT_ERR, "%s: timing_init() failed (%s)", drvthis->name, strerror(errno));
return -1;
}
// Allocate our framebuffer
framebuf = (unsigned char *) calloc(122 * 4, sizeof(unsigned char));
if (framebuf == NULL) {
report(RPT_ERR, "%s: unable to allocate framebuffer", drvthis->name);
// sed1520_close ();
return -1;
}
// clear screen
memset (framebuf, '\0', 122 * 4);
// Initialize the Port and the sed1520s
if (port_access(port) || port_access(port+2)) {
report(RPT_ERR, "%s: unable to access port 0x%03X", drvthis->name, port);
return -1;
}
port_out(port,0);
port_out(port +2, WR + CS2);
writecommand(port, 0xE2, CS1 + CS2);
writecommand(port, 0xAF, CS1 + CS2);
writecommand(port, 0xC0, CS1 + CS2);
selectpage(port, 3);
cellwidth = 6;
cellheight = 8;
report(RPT_DEBUG, "%s: init() done", drvthis->name);
return 0;
}

/////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////
//
// Flushes all output to the lcd...
//
MODULE_EXPORT void
sed1520_flush (Driver *drvthis)
{
int i, j;
for (i = 0; i < 4; i++) {
selectpage(port, i);
selectcolumn(port, 0, CS2) ;
for (j = 0; j < 61; j++)
writedata(port, framebuf[j + (i * 122)], CS2);
selectcolumn(port, 0, CS1) ;
for (j = 61; j < 122; j++)
writedata(port, framebuf[j + (i * 122)], CS1);
}
}

/////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////
// Changes the font of character n to a pattern given by *dat.
// HD44780 Controllers only posses 8 programmable chars. But
// we store the fontmap completely in RAM, so every character
// can be altered. !Important: Characters have to be redraw
// by drawchar2fb() to show their new shape. Because we use
// a non-standard 6x8 font a *dat not calculated from
// widthth and sed1520->height will fail.
//
MODULE_EXPORT void
sed1520_set_char (Driver *drvthis, int n, char *dat)
{
int row, col, i;
if (n < 0 || n > 255)
return;
if (!dat)
return;
for (row = 0; row < 8; row++) {
i = 0;
for (col = 0; col < 6; col++) {
i <<= 1;
i |= (dat[(row * 6) + col] > 0);
}
fontmap[n][row] = i;
}
}
